CIVIVI Governor stands out as the lightest option for weight, with about a 1% gap from the closest alternative. CRKT Homefront Hunter stands out as the cheapest option for retail price, with about a 35% gap from the closest alternative.

CIVIVI Governor — Blade length: 98 mm (3.86 in)CIVIVI Governor — Overall length: 222 mm (8.74 in)CIVIVI Governor — Closed length: 124 mm (4.88 in)CIVIVI Governor — Blade thickness: 3 mm (0.12 in)CIVIVI Governor — Weight: 118 g (4.16 oz)CIVIVI Governor — Retail price: US$65CRKT Homefront Hunter — Blade length: 90.4 mm (3.56 in)CRKT Homefront Hunter — Overall length: 211.15 mm (8.31 in)CRKT Homefront Hunter — Closed length: 120.27 mm (4.74 in)CRKT Homefront Hunter — Blade thickness: 3.4 mm (0.13 in)CRKT Homefront Hunter — Weight: 119.07 g (4.20 oz)CRKT Homefront Hunter — Retail price: US$41.99Blade lengthOverall lengthClosed lengthBlade thicknessWeightRetail price
